11 The Lord spoke to Moses face to face as a man speaks with his friend. Then Moses would return to the camp. But Moses’ young helper, Joshua son of Nun, did not leave the Tent.

12 Moses said to the Lord, “You have told me to lead these people. But you did not say whom you would send with me. You have said to me, ‘I know you very well. I am pleased with you.’ 13 If I have truly pleased you, show me your plans. Then I may know you and continue to please you. Remember that this nation is your people.”
